Harry Lambert invited to speak at the ‘Neurotechnology in the workplace – Employment Law’ event

Harry Lambert will be speaking at the ‘Neurotechnology in the workplace – Employment Law’ event, on Thursday 26th June 2025.

Harry Lambert, the Founder and Head of Centre for Neurotechnology and Law and Cerebralink Neurotech Consultancy has been invited to speak at the ‘Neurotechnology in the workplace – Employment Law’ event taking place at Panagram on Thursday, 26th June 2025.

This event will highlight the crossroads of neurotechnology and employment law, how the law may apply to various scenarios involving neurotechnology in the workplace and whether the current framework, borne of an analogue age, may be ill equipped for the age of neurotechnology.

Harry Lambert will be giving a welcome note to the audience, followed by a discussion by Allan McCay of The Sydney Institute of Criminology, Liana Wood and Ryan Bradshaw of Leigh Day. Gene Matthews will Chair the event.

Harry Lambert specialises in the areas of product liability, medical tech, clinical negligencepersonal injury, and human rights law. He is also renowned for his expertise in group litigation claims relating to these areas. A unique aspect to his legal practice, Harry has a particular interest in and a passion for the intersection of law and emerging technologies. He is dedicated to staying at the forefront of technological developments to better serve his clients in cases involving data privacy, and tech-related legal issues. Harry’s 12-part series on Neurotechnology and The Law has garnered academic acclaim, been translated into several European languages, and turned into a podcast run by the Italian equivalent of the Financial Times.
